Marilyn J. (Tinker) Clarke, 87, passed away peacefully at the Nevins Nursing and Rehab Center in Methuen, on Thursday, September 12, 2019. Born in Milbridge, ME to the late Clarence and Agnes (Robinson) Tinker, she was raised in Stonington, ME. Marilyn moved to Massachusetts in her 20s and remained there for the duration of her life working in businesses in Lawrence and Methuen. She was predeceased by her son, Clarence Hayward and her husband, Herbert Clarke.
A creative person, Marilyn enjoyed journaling, knitting, crocheting, embroidery and crafts of any kind. She was an artist who met her husband of 20 years, Herbert, in a painting class. Their passion for painting on any surface including slate, canvas, wood and sketching on paper led them to create an art studio in the home they shared in Methuen.
Bingo was a favorite activity of Marilyn’s as well as bus trips to Foxwoods Casino with the Methuen Seniors. Marilyn was active in TOPS and the Methuen Housing Authority Tenant Association, holding positions on their councils over the years. After retirement, she volunteered at the Holy Family Cancer Center.
Growing up on an island, Marilyn will be remembered for her love of lighthouses and her collection of lighthouse statues. She also had a love for squirrels with many statues and stuffed squirrels around the house. A movie enthusiast, she had an extensive collection of VHS tapes. She was a Boston Red Sox fan.
Marilyn will be missed by her many friends at the Methuen Housing Authority Mystic Street Complex and Nevins Nursing and Rehab Center. She held a special place in the hearts of friends, Carole and Denise Gosselin.
